1:1 Child Life  Services

In person (GTA) or virtual supports for children under 18 years. Support services can include: medical procedure preparation, diagnosis education, coping with or preparing for loss, diagnosis or illness education, coping after a hospitalization, processing childhood cancer survivorship, and more.

Professional Consultation

Available to healthcare organizations, schools, and community programs seeking to enhance emotionally safe and atraumatic care. Working together with teams to assess, build, and support  meaningful services through training, guidance,  program development and more.

Student Mentorship

Guidance is available to individuals pursuing child life certification and the CCLS credential.

These services are offered based on clinician availability and can include resume review, application review, and interview preparation. Please reach out for more details - availability for this service is not guaranteed.

What service is right for my child?

Great question! The short answer? It depends. 

Some families seek 1:1 child life services for support with needle fears and injection or bloodwork support, preparation for procedures like surgery or dental work, education on illnesses that may be occurring in their life or family, preparation for a death of someone close to them, or a funeral. 

​

Child Life Specialists cater all interventions to the unique needs of each child they're working with, with an emphasis on developmentally-appropriate language, play and emotional expression.
